Lead is a material used to create the radiation suit. It's relatively easy to craft, as it only requires materials found in Safe Shallows and Grassy Plateaus.

Trivia
- In real life Lead is a distinct element and cannot be created by combining copper and silver.
- The recipe used to make Lead in the game is similar to the composition of the alloy Shibuichi.
